Citizens Advice County Durham - Bishop Auckland
Advice: Money, Housing & Work · Charity · Bishop Auckland (County Durham)
Local advice office in Bishop Auckland for debt, benefits, housing and consumer help.
The Bishop Auckland office of Citizens Advice County Durham works from the Four Clocks Centre on Newgate Street. Advisers help people across the south-west of the county with welfare benefits, debt, Universal Credit, housing, energy bills and employment issues. Weekly debt clinics also run at Woodhouse Close Community Centre. Appointments can be booked through the Adviceline and many issues can be dealt with by phone or webchat.
